7 Can Taco Soup

This 7 Can Taco Soup is super easy to make. Made with 7 cans of hearty ingredients with some good taco seasoning this will be a soup everyone loves!
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Course Dinner, Main Course, Soup
Cuisine Mexican, Soup, Tex-Mex
Servings 10 servings
Calories 250 kcal

Ingredients
  

7 Can Soup

  • 12.5 oz canned chicken breast
  • 15.25 oz black beans (rinsed and drained)
  • 15.25 oz kidney beans (rinsed and drained)
  • 15.25 oz pinto beans (rinsed and drained)
  • 15.25 oz corn (drained)
  • 10 oz Rotel (drained)
  • 14 oz chicken broth (1 can)

Seasoning:

  • ½ oz taco seasoning (or to taste)
  • ½ oz dry ranch seasoning mix (or to taste)

Instructions
 

  • Drain chicken and use a fork to break up the chunks of chicken.
  • Place all ingredients into a pot and season to taste. Bring soup to a boil then reduce heat and cover.
  • Allow to simmer for15-20 minutes. Serve topped with your favorite taco toppings.

Notes

What to serve with taco soup:
I love serving my taco soup with traditional taco ingredients. Some tortilla chips to dip in the soup. Add some sour cream and cheddar cheese to the top of the soup. Sliced jalapenos will add some extra heat if you would like.
